Never Open A Franchise If This Is The Reason Why!

Posted by Jeff Lefler November 9, 2016

Live the American Dream! Be in business for yourself but not by yourself! Great marketing pitches are designed to get you to want to buy a franchise. If someone tells you there’s this turnkey business that’s just waiting for you to invest into and it’s a proven business model and can’t fail – run away. Every business, including franchised businesses have risk. They are not turnkey. If you are opening a franchise for one of these reasons – stop. Reconsider!

QSR Trends: Millennials in Franchising

Posted by Franchise Grade Team October 21, 2016

There’s no question that the Millennials are having a significant impact on all areas of business, and on the franchising industry in particular. They represent both customer side and the ownership side of the franchising equation. On the ownership side, Millennials represent not only the youngest group, but the most advanced, tech-savvy individuals in the industry. So how does that affect the QSR industry? We’re already seeing the impact these young innovators are having, particularly in the technology of QSR franchising. These folks grew up with modern technology and have seen the quantum leaps that have been made in the past 20 years. So it’s only natural that they would want to use and improve technology to be compatible with their own entrepreneurial spirit and drive in the franchising industry. Many of their visions have already come to fruition.
